Understanding Singed’s Unique Playstyle

Learning how to play Singed begins with understanding that he’s unlike any other champion in League of Legends. The Mad Chemist thrives on chaos, misdirection, and psychological warfare rather than direct confrontation. His poison trail mechanic forms the core of his identity, allowing him to deal damage without standing still or targeting specific enemies.

Singed excels at split pushing, wave control, and creating map pressure that forces enemies to respond. Unlike champions that rely on skill shots or auto attacks, Singed deals damage by simply running around – making him one of the most unique top laners in the game.

The key to mastering Singed lies in understanding his role as a disruptor. Similar to how Shaco creates chaos with his mind games, Singed does so by forcing opponents into no-win situations. Chase him, and you take poison damage while he leads you into traps. Ignore him, and he’ll freely proxy farm and take objectives.

Your primary goal when playing Singed is to become an irritating presence that the enemy team cannot ignore but also cannot deal with effectively. This creates openings for your team to secure objectives while multiple enemies are distracted trying to shut you down.

Optimal Runes and Item Builds

To effectively learn how to play Singed, you need to understand his optimal rune selections and item builds. The right setup can dramatically enhance Singed’s strengths while mitigating his weaknesses.

For runes, Conqueror and Aftershock are your primary keystone options depending on playstyle. Conqueror provides sustained damage and healing in extended fights, while Aftershock offers defensive stats when you fling an enemy, making it ideal against burst-heavy compositions.

Your secondary rune path typically includes Resolve or Inspiration. Key runes to consider include:

  • Nimbus Cloak + Celerity (for enhanced movement speed)
  • Time Warp Tonic + Biscuit Delivery (for sustain)
  • Unflinching + Conditioning (for tenacity and resistances)

For items, Singed’s core build typically revolves around Rylai’s Crystal Scepter for the slow effect on your poison, which makes kiting easier. According to official League statistics, Singed players who rush Rylai’s maintain a consistently higher win rate.

After your core item, adapt your build based on the enemy team composition:

  • Demonic Embrace for damage and tankiness
  • Dead Man’s Plate for armor and movement speed
  • Force of Nature against heavy AP teams
  • Thornmail to counter healing champions
  • Turbo Chemtank for engage potential

Remember that Singed thrives on movement speed, so prioritize items that allow you to kite enemies more effectively. Much like Rammus relies on his rolling mobility, Singed needs to stay fast to be effective.

Effective Laning Strategies

When learning how to play Singed, your approach to the laning phase will differ significantly from most top laners. Unlike Darius who seeks to dominate through direct confrontation, Singed often avoids traditional laning altogether.

If you choose to lane conventionally, understand your power spikes. Singed has a surprisingly strong level 2 all-in with Poison Trail and Fling. Against melee champions, you can often secure first blood by poisoning the first wave, reaching level 2 first, then flinging the enemy into your minions while poisoning them.

During laning, use the brush to your advantage. Step in and out while leaving your poison trail to make it difficult for enemies to trade effectively. Your poison allows you to farm without directly approaching minions, reducing your vulnerability to harass.

Against ranged opponents, patience is crucial. Similar to how Malphite weathers early harassment, you’ll need to concede some CS in the early game. Focus on staying healthy and catching waves under tower until you have your ultimate and first item.

Wave management is particularly important for Singed. You want to either fully push and roam/proxy or freeze near your tower to set up ganks with your fling. Avoid getting caught in the middle of the lane where you’re vulnerable to ganks without an escape route.

Remember these key laning tips:

  • Use Poison Trail to last hit multiple minions simultaneously
  • Conserve mana in the early game by toggling poison carefully
  • Look for opportunities to roam to mid after pushing
  • Use your ultimate for survivability rather than saving it for “perfect moments”
  • Don’t be afraid to teleport back to lane early if it means securing a item advantage

As top Singed players demonstrate, successful laning isn’t about winning every trade but creating pressure that forces responses from the enemy team.

Team Fight Positioning and Tactics

Mastering how to play Singed in team fights requires understanding your role as a disruptor rather than a traditional tank. Your goal is to create chaos, separate enemies, and apply your poison to as many opponents as possible.

As teamfights approach, look to flank rather than engage head-on. Similar to Shen’s tactical positioning, your approach should be calculated rather than reckless. Position yourself to cut off escape routes or to access the enemy backline.

Your ultimate provides significant stat boosts that make you deceptively tanky, so activate it before fully committing to a fight. This allows you to survive longer while spreading your poison trail across multiple targets.

Fling is your most powerful disruption tool. Use it strategically to:

  • Isolate priority targets like the enemy ADC or mid laner
  • Peel dangerous divers off your carries
  • Interrupt channeled abilities or dashes
  • Throw enemies into your waiting team

Your W (Mega Adhesive) creates zones that slow enemies and ground them, preventing dashes. Place it in choke points during objectives or to cover retreat paths when your team needs to disengage.

In extended teamfights, weave in and out of combat to refresh your poison trail and avoid focus fire. Unlike Dr. Mundo who can stay in the fray constantly, Singed benefits from a hit-and-run approach.

Remember that your value often comes from forcing enemies to make mistakes. By running through their formation, you create split-second decisions that often lead to positioning errors you and your team can capitalize on.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When learning how to play Singed effectively, being aware of common pitfalls can accelerate your mastery. Many new Singed players make mistakes that undermine their effectiveness and impact on the game.

One frequent error is over-committing to proxy farming when behind. While proxying is a signature Singed strategy, it requires proper timing and awareness. If you’re already at a disadvantage, proxying can lead to repeated deaths and further snowball the enemy team’s lead.

Another mistake is misusing your Fling ability. Unlike Garen’s straightforward ability rotation, Singed’s Fling requires careful consideration of positioning and timing. Flinging the wrong target or using it too early in a skirmish can waste its powerful disruption potential.

Many players also struggle with mana management on Singed. Leaving your poison trail on continuously will quickly drain your mana pool, especially in the early game. Learn to toggle it efficiently, turning it on to last hit or trade, then off when not needed.

Avoid the temptation to build full AP on Singed. While the damage scaling might seem appealing, Singed needs survivability to fulfill his role. A proper balance of damage and tankiness similar to Sett’s bruiser build path will yield better results.

Finally, don’t fall into the trap of mindlessly running at enemies. Strategic movement is key to playing Singed effectively. Every movement should have purpose – whether creating space, applying pressure, or setting up for objectives.

To improve your Singed gameplay, try recording your matches and analyzing these common issues:

  • Times you died while proxying without gaining an advantage elsewhere
  • Instances where you used Fling suboptimally
  • Moments when you ran out of mana during crucial fights
  • Teamfights where you failed to disrupt the enemy formation
  • Opportunities for roaming or teleport plays you missed

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Singed good for beginners in League of Legends?

Singed has a low mechanical skill floor but a high strategic ceiling, making him accessible for beginners but requiring good game knowledge to master fully. New players can learn the basics quickly, but truly effective proxy farming and map pressure tactics take time to develop.

How do I deal with ranged matchups as Singed?

Against ranged opponents, start with Doran’s Shield and Second Wind rune, then focus on surviving until level 6 and your first item. Consider an early proxy strategy to avoid direct confrontation, or request jungle assistance to punish their forward positioning.

When should I proxy farm with Singed?

Proxy farming is most effective when you have vision control, know the enemy jungler’s location, or can create pressure elsewhere on the map. Good timing includes after pushing your wave, when your ultimate is available for escape, or when your team is contesting objectives on the opposite side of the map.

What’s the best way to use Singed’s ultimate?

Use Insanity Potion proactively rather than reactively – activate it before engaging in teamfights or when initiating a proxy farm. The stats boost allows you to survive longer while spreading poison and creating disruption, and the cooldown is relatively short for a powerful ultimate.

How important is movement speed on Singed?

Movement speed is arguably Singed’s most important stat after survivability, as it enables him to apply poison efficiently, escape dangerous situations, and chase down targets. Always prioritize items with movement speed components like Dead Man’s Plate and Force of Nature, and consider runes like Celerity to enhance your mobility further.
